Year: 2020
Runtime: 96 min
Language: English
Director: Jose Magan
Amidst the harsh, snow-covered mountains of Armenia, two Roman legions struggle to survive during a devastating invasion by Parthia. As the relentless winter takes its toll, Noreno, a courageous and determined half-Roman soldier, steps forward. Driven by a strong sense of duty, he undertakes a dangerous rescue mission, leading his men across treacherous landscapes in a desperate attempt to turn the tide of the brutal conflict and save his fellow soldiers.

In the frozen reaches of Armenia, the relentless bite of winter presses against the battered remnants of Rome’s far‑flung forces. Two Roman legions, already strained by a devastating Parthian invasion, find themselves isolated on a snow‑cloaked plateau where every gust threatens to swallow men and morale alike. The landscape itself feels like an antagonist, its howling winds and treacherous passes turning each step into a test of endurance. Yet amid the bleakness, a faint ember of resolve glows, hinting that survival may depend as much on will as on steel.
At the heart of this desperate tableau stands Noreno, a half‑Roman soldier whose lineage gives him a foot in both worlds and a unique perspective on duty. Raised among the disciplined rigor of the legions yet intimately aware of the harsher realities beyond the empire’s borders, he embodies the tension between classical order and raw survival. His determination is not merely personal; it reflects a deeper sense of responsibility toward his comrades, the men who look to him as a beacon in the white‑out gloom.
The film’s tone blends stark, atmospheric dread with moments of gritty camaraderie. The relentless cold creates an almost palpable pressure, while the ragged ranks of the legionaries move like a living skeleton through the snow, bound together by loyalty and the unspoken promise of rescue. Noreno’s leadership is tested not by grand strategies but by the simple, brutal need to keep a group of weary soldiers alive long enough to reach safety. This juxtaposition of ancient Roman valor against an unforgiving natural world sets a mood that is both hauntingly beautiful and fiercely urgent, inviting viewers to wonder how far a man will go when the only thing standing between his men and oblivion is his resolve.
